
Queeratorio
A queer, underground pop night.
Queeratorio is an experimental performance set in a church, reimagining the structure of the Holy Mass. It is a queer, pop-inspired, and witty production designed to foster community and explore queer spirituality. The audience is invited to move and sing along to iconic songs by artists like Madonna, Björk, Britney Spears, and Elton John. The project seeks to create a space for collective reflection, laughter, and emotional connection. A portion of ticket donations supports queer mutual aid in Lebanon. Please note the performance includes a brief description of physical or sexual violence.
